Output c3c6088e30f8ee811933445785c3d510b0c107f98c6dd7c9b0dfcaf15b3dfdea:713

value
190830
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c17c787d1588f4c2c5ea3d05f5067194531091fe OP_EQUAL
address
3KL5SwURUDCznkf1JFo3uvKsBjzbaEt7ez
transaction
c3c6088e30f8ee811933445785c3d510b0c107f98c6dd7c9b0dfcaf15b3dfdea
confirmations
362105
spent
true